Negotiating power: examining the role of procedural elements in international peace talks
<p>Peace agreements don’t write themselves. They are negotiated — in complex, iterative sessions with highly contingent results. Diplomats take pains to establish a negotiation’s procedural elements (e.g., timing, venue, and rules of engagement) in advance; they often contest or adapt these el...
